Many people falsely interpret eemaan to mean faith or belief in one’s heart. However, this is not the way the messenger Muhammad (saw) and his companions (may Allah be pleased with them all) understood eemaan to be. Allah (swt) says in the Qur’aan:
“If they believe the way you believe (Sahabah), they will be guided. And if they go astray, they will be in complete contradiction…” (EMQ Soorah Al-Baqarah, 2: 137)
